Money Management: The Key to Financial Stability
Managing money effectively is crucial for maintaining financial stability in the home. Here are some key strategies to consider:
Strategy | Description |
---|---|
Budgeting | Creating a budget helps you track your income and expenses, ensuring that you live within your means. |
Savings | Setting aside a portion of your income for savings ensures that you have a financial cushion for emergencies and future goals. |
Investing | Investing your money in various assets can help grow your wealth over time, providing a source of passive income. |
Debt Management | Managing and paying off debts, especially high-interest debts, is essential for maintaining financial stability. |

Creating a Financially Secure Future
Planning for the future is essential for ensuring financial security for your family. Here are some steps to consider:
-
Life Insurance: Protecting your family with life insurance can provide financial support in case of an unexpected event.
-
Estate Planning: Creating an estate plan ensures that your assets are distributed according to your wishes, minimizing potential conflicts.
-
Education Planning: Saving for your children’s education can help alleviate the financial burden of higher education.
